I was pleasantly surprised by 'Zahav.' It’s not just another collection of recipes—it’s a deep dive into the heart of Israeli food. The author’s passion shines through, and the way he breaks down techniques makes even intimidating dishes feel doable. I laughed at how obsessed he is with tahini (there’s a whole chapter dedicated to it), but after trying his methods, I get it. The book balances tradition with modern twists, so it never feels outdated or gimmicky.

What I love most is how versatile it is. You can whip up a quick weeknight meal or go all out for a feast. The salads alone are worth the price—bright, fresh, and packed with textures. And if you’re into baking, the bread and pastry sections are heavenly. My only gripe? Some ingredients require a bit of hunting, but that’s part of the fun. It’s a book that makes cooking feel like an adventure.

Are there books like Zahav: A World of Israeli Cooking?

3 답변2025-12-31 23:04:12
I adore cookbooks that weave culture and cuisine together like 'Zahav' does, and there are definitely gems out there with a similar vibe. 'Jerusalem' by Yotam Ottolenghi and Sami Tamimi is one of my favorites—it’s packed with vibrant recipes and stories that dive deep into the food traditions of Jerusalem. The way it balances personal narratives with dishes like mejadra or shakshuka makes it feel like a culinary journey. Another standout is 'Persiana' by Sabrina Ghayour, which celebrates Persian flavors with the same lush photography and heartfelt storytelling. Both books have that same magic of making you taste the culture, not just the ingredients. If you’re after something broader but equally rich, 'The Food of Sichuan' by Fuchsia Dunlop is a masterclass in regional Chinese cooking, with layers of history and technique. It’s less about personal memoir and more about meticulous detail, but the passion for the cuisine jumps off the page. For a Mediterranean twist, 'Olives, Lemons & Za’atar' by Rawia Bishara nails the blend of family stories and recipes—it’s like inheriting a grandmother’s kitchen secrets. Honestly, any of these could sit proudly next to 'Zahav' on your shelf.

What happens in Zahav: A World of Israeli Cooking?

3 답변2025-12-31 13:04:31
Zahav: A World of Israeli Cooking' isn't just a cookbook—it's a love letter to the vibrant, chaotic, and deeply flavorful world of Israeli cuisine. Michael Solomonov, the James Beard Award-winning chef, takes you on a journey through his personal and culinary roots, from the bustling markets of Tel Aviv to the traditions of Jewish diaspora cooking. The recipes are a mix of bold, spice-forward dishes like his famous hummus and crispy, slow-cooked chicken schnitzel, but what really stands out are the stories. He weaves in memories of his brother’s military service, the influence of Moroccan and Yemeni flavors, and the communal spirit of Israeli dining. What I adore is how accessible he makes everything. Even if you’ve never worked with tahini or pomegranate molasses, his instructions are clear, and the results feel like magic. The book also dives into the importance of 'salatim,' those tiny, mezze-style salads that turn a meal into a feast. It’s the kind of book that makes you want to invite friends over, spread out a dozen little plates, and eat with your hands. After trying his recipe for roasted eggplant with amba (a tangy mango pickle), I’ve basically ruined all other eggplants for myself—nothing compares.

What are the best recipes in Zahav: A World of Israeli Cooking?

3 답변2025-12-31 08:52:00
Zahav: A World of Israeli Cooking' is a treasure trove of vibrant flavors, and some recipes stand out like stars in a culinary galaxy. The hummus tehina is legendary—creamy, rich, and utterly addictive. It’s not just about blending chickpeas and tahini; the technique of soaking the beans overnight and cooking them until they’re fall-apart tender makes all the difference. I love serving it with warm, fluffy pita and a drizzle of olive oil. Another showstopper is the crispy eggplant with labneh. The eggplant slices are fried to golden perfection, then layered with cool, tangy labneh and a sprinkle of za’atar. It’s a textural dream. Then there’s the chicken shawarma, marinated in a spiced yogurt blend that tenderizes the meat while infusing it with deep, aromatic flavors. Roasting it on a skewer gives it that signature charred edge. And don’t even get me started on the malabi—a rosewater-scented milk pudding topped with pistachios and pomegranate seeds. It’s like dessert poetry. These recipes aren’t just meals; they’re experiences that transport you straight to the bustling markets of Tel Aviv.
